HOLLAND, MI (WHTC-AM/FM, Sept. 14, 2022) – The NEA Big Read Lakeshore, organized by Hope College, will host 101 events across the West Michigan Lakeshore, from Saugatuck to Holland to Muskegon, this November. The events will be centered around the program’s previously announced book choices: Circe by Madeline Miller, The Odyssey by Homer, Zita the Spacegirl by Ben Hatke, Superman by Matt de la Peña and The Last Stop on Market Street by Matt de la Peña. The program will notably host authors of this year’s chosen books along with multimodal events ranging from culinary experiences to outdoor adventures. With a multitude of events for all ages, there is sure to be something for every member of the family.
The new partnerships with Muskegon Area District Library and the Muskegon Area Intermediate School District expand the program geographically, but also in quantity and quality. Lakeshore residents are encouraged to explore new cities by attending events in various cities this year.

Additionally, the Big Read partnered with computer science students at Hope College to create a reading discussion app. The app and instructions for participation are available at synlesa.com.
